oovoosetup.exe

ooVoo

Software Association LLC

The application oovoosetup.exe by Software Association has been detected as a potentially unwanted program by 1 anti-malware scanner with very strong indications that the file is a potential threat. The program is a setup application that uses the NSIS (Nullsoft Scriptable Install System) installer. The installer uses the OpenCandy monitzation platform which will donwload and install offers in the setup for potentially unwanted software including ad/search-supported toolbars. The file has been seen being downloaded from oovoo.1800download.com.
